SCOTTSVILLE, Ky. (FOX 56) — A Scottsville man has been arrested after the Mennonite community reported one of its members for having sex with a 15-year-old girl.

Donald Stoner, 31, was arrested on the morning of Tuesday, Sept. 2, by the Allen County Sheriff's Department. According to court documents, the Mennonite community contacted deputies after Stoner allegedly confessed to having sex with a family member.

It began in 2022, per an arrest citation, and the girl was 15 years old at the time.

Stoner was charged with third-degree rape and incest.

He was lodged in the Allen County Detention Center. An investigation into the report is still ongoing.
